: According to official MathWorks Support , there is no way to convert P-code back to source. Debugging is also heavily restricted or entirely prevented in modern versions to maintain security. Blog Post: The Mystery of the "P-Code Decoder"

Opening a .p file in a text editor reveals a stream of unreadable binary data and cryptographic signatures, hiding the original logic, variables, and comments. Evolution of P-Code Security

: By design, there is no built-in or documented way to convert a .p file back into its original .m source file.

Several specialized decoders have emerged, often with unique claims and origins. The by "datahackor" on GitHub is one such tool, claiming to decode nearly all versions of MATLAB P-code, with the exception of "very ancient versions". The author describes a long journey of reverse engineering, spurred by a challenge from a colleague, eventually leading to a "universal" method that can restore code down to the exact line count, albeit without original comments.
